THE SCHOOL OF CONTEMPLATIVE LIFE
The purpose of The School of Contemplative Life is to teach meditation from the Christian wisdom tradition as spiritual path to peace, community and oneness. Please refer to www.schoolofcontemplativelife.com for our aims.
Financial health, per its FY2024 accounts
The accounts state that total income increased to £210,511 from £189,605 in the prior year, driven by growth in grassroots donations and ticket sales. The charity reports unrestricted reserves of £9,576, which the trustees note exceeds their stated policy target of £5,000 to £7,000. The filing confirms there are no material uncertainties regarding the charity's ability to continue as a going concern.
What the accounts disclose
“No employee received employee benefits of more than £60,000 during the year” — page 16
“The board has agreed to keep the equivalent of nine to twelve months fixed costs in reserve (which equates to £5k - 7k at the date of writing this report).” — page 6
“During 2024 C Whittington, trustee, was paid a salary of £8,144 and consultancy fees of £2,500. His wife, R Sharpe, was paid a salary of £7,556.” — page 16
